Dutchess County is located in southeastern New York State, between the Hudson River on its west and the New York-Connecticut border on its east, about halfway between the cities of Albany and New York. Dutchess County was one of the first 12 counties that were established in the Province of New York in 1683.

The Dutchess County LSWMP, or Local Solid Waste Management Plan, is a framework designed to manage solid waste in Dutchess County, New York, outlining strategies for waste reduction, recycling, and proper disposal methods.
Entities such as municipalities, private waste management companies, and businesses generating certain amounts of waste are required to file the Dutchess County LSWMP to ensure compliance with local waste management regulations.
To fill out the Dutchess County LSWMP, organizations must provide detailed information about their waste management practices, including waste generation estimates, recycling efforts, and compliance with local regulations, typically using provided templates or forms.
The purpose of the Dutchess County LSWMP is to promote sustainable waste management practices, reduce landfill use, enhance recycling programs, and ensure compliance with environmental regulations.
The information that must be reported on the Dutchess County LSWMP includes the types and amounts of solid waste generated, recycling rates, waste management strategies, and any associated environmental impacts.
